TURN-208: Gatevale turnstile counters at the Merrow Field pilot double-count when a rotation reverses mid-cycle. Attendance totals drift roughly 2% high per event. The debounce window fix is implemented, reviewed by Ilsa, and soak-tested across two simulated match days without drift. Ready for your cut; the candidate build is identified below.

trace token, tagag-tafog: htk6_5ed18c

Visitor Policy — Quiet Room, Level 9 (Tollbright House). Visiting contractors may use the top-floor quiet room for calls or focused work between 09:00 and 17:00. Food is not permitted, and conversations must be taken to the adjacent lounge. The room is capped at four occupants at any time. Access is controlled by a keypad; contractors should use the entry code provided below.

door code, bajef-taduf: bdg-XBH-3

## Deploying the Gatewick Proctor Queue

Deploys are pretty painless: push to main, wait for the pipeline, then watch the queue drain dashboard for five minutes. If candidates pile up mid-exam, roll back first and ask questions later — the queue replays safely. Everything the workers care about lives in one config block, shown here for reference.

settings of bafof-yagef:
JOROX_PIN=8740
JOROX_TENANT=pelox
JOROX_METRICS_HOST=metrics.jorox.qorvelworks.internal
JOROX_SEAL=seal_c78f63c1
JOROX_STANDBY_TEAM=norax